#678cef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#678cef is composed of 40.4% red, 54.9%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.9% cyan, 41.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 223.7 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 67.1%. #678cef color hex could be obtained by blending #ceffff with #0019df.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#678cef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#678cef has RGB values of R:103, G:140,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 6786287.
Hex triplet | 678cef | #678cef |
---|---|---|
RGB Decimal | 103, 140, 239 | rgb(103,140,239) |
RGB Percent | 40.4, 54.9, 93.7 | rgb(40.4%,54.9%,93.7%) |
CMYK | 57, 41, 0, 6 | |
HSL | 223.7°, 81, 67.1 | hsl(223.7,81%,67.1%) |
HSV (or HSB) | 223.7°, 56.9, 93.7 | |
Web Safe | 6699ff | #6699ff |
CIE-LAB | 59.771, 15.894, -53.822 |
---|---|
XYZ | 30.548, 27.87, 85.426 |
xyY | 0.212, 0.194, 27.87 |
CIE-LCH | 59.771, 56.12, 286.452 |
CIE-LUV | 59.771, -19.027, -87.405 |
Hunter-Lab | 52.792, 10.903, -58.986 |
Binary | 01100111, 10001100, 11101111 |
